Sigstore Timestamp Authority is a service for issuing RFC 3161 timestamps. Prior to 2.1.0, the global wrapMetrics middleware records raw HTTP request path r.URL.Path and raw HTTP request method r.Method as Prometheus labels for latency and request count metric vectors before routing, allowing an unauthenticated remote attacker to issue requests with random paths such as /api/v1/timestamp/<uuid> or random HTTP methods and create unbounded permanent time-series entries that exhaust memory. This issue is fixed in version 2.1.0.
